PAO Novatek has signed a trilateral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with Marubeni Corp. and Mitsui O.S.K. Lines Ltd (MOL).
The MOU defines includes a specific action plan to explore the opportunities to establish an LNG transshipment and marketing complex in the Kamchatka Region, Russia, including investments in this infrastructure project.
The Chairman of Novatek’s Management Board, Leonid Mikhelson, commented: "One of the main advantages of creating an LNG transshipment terminal at Kamchatka is its close proximity to consumers and the opportunity to ensure flexible sales terms for the key consuming markets of the Asian-Pacific region. The MOU demonstrates a high market interest and relevancy for this type of project to address market needs.”
